The situation is described below:
<aDSL ethernet> - 10.0.0.0/24 - <FREEBSD Firewall> - 192.168.1.0/24
- <clients>
ed1/tun0 ep0
So...
All outcoming packets are 'nated' by the firewall, which is a very small
computer (a P100 with only 24 Mo RAM and a little hard drive..). So this
computer must not do an other thing than firewalling, routing or nating
packets.
But, I would like offer ftp and telnet services on an another computer behind
the firewall for computers inside and outside of the LAN.
I think that natd would do perfectly this job, but natd already run on
interface tun0 for Internet access.
What can I do to offer theses services ?
